          SB 205:   revise the procedure for establishing the tax levy for a school district sending students to an adjoining school district.

Proponents:      Senator Duxbury
          Gene Enk, Executive Director, Associated School Boards of South Dakota

Opponents:      Todd Vik, Department of Education & Cultural Affairs
          Jim Fry, Department of Revenue

MOTION:      AMEND SB 205

f-205a

     On the printed bill, delete everything after the enacting clause and insert:

"
     Section 1. That § 13-11-10 be amended by adding a new subdivision to read as follows:


             (5)    The sum of the levies assessed for all funds, except the bond redemption fund, in the sending district shall be equal to or greater than the sum of all levies for all funds, except the bond redemption fund, in the receiving district. "


Moved by:      Senator Olson
Second by:      Senator Flowers
Action:      Was not acted on.

MOTION:      SUBSTITUTE MOTION AMEND THE AMENDMENT

f-205

     On the printed bill, delete everything after the enacting clause and insert:

"
     Section 1. That § 13-11-10 be amended by adding a new subdivision to read as follows:

             (5)    The sum of the levies assessed for all funds in the sending district shall be equal to or greater than the sum of all levies for all funds in the receiving district. "


Moved by:      Senator Daugaard
Second by:      Senator Brown (Arnold)
Action:      Prevailed by voice vote.

MOTION:      DO PASS SB 205 AS AMENDED

Moved by:      Senator Olson
Second by:      Senator Brown (Arnold)
Action:      Prevailed by roll call vote.   (9-0-0-0)

Voting yes:      Albers, Brown (Arnold), Daugaard, Flowers, Moore, Olson, Valandra, Brosz, Paisley
